Remember When UNLV Committed Ed O'Bannon...
and Shon Tarver? Both were Top 100 kids from the west coast...O'Bannon was actually a Top 20 kid...Ed was a 6-8 forward and Tarver was a 6-5 guard...both would have played on the UNLV team that suffered it's only loss in the Final Four...interesting ESPN story, which touches briefly on that period of time...
